However, John Wycliffe is also credited for making a similar statement in 1383, as is Charles Dickens for a comment he made in 1844. Bible or Not goes on to say that while the phrase "charity begins at home" is not a biblical scripture, the concept could easily have come from 1 Timothy 5:4, where Paul tells Timothy to make sure the widows are taken care of by their own families first, … Yet the exact origin of the phrase is still debated.
